Monitoring quinolone resistance due to <i>Haemophilus influenzae</i> mutations (2012–17)

2019-05-09

Abstract excerpt

Among drug-resistant bacteria of recent concern, we determined minimum inhibitory concentrations (MICs) of six different quinolone antibacterial agents in Haemophilus influenzae and performed molecular genetic analysis in addition to the exploration for β-lactamase-producing and β-lactamase negative ampicillin-resistant H. influenzae (BLNAR).
